Factors to Consider When Choosing Stainless Steel Workbench With Drawers
Selecting the right stainless steel workbench with drawers involves considering several key factors that impact long-term satisfaction and performance. Size and workspace should match your available area and project scope, while drawer configuration influences organization and accessibility. Material quality determines durability, especially in environments with moisture or heavy use. Price points vary widely, so understanding what features are essential versus optional helps avoid overspending. Lastly, additional features like shelves or paper holders can boost convenience but should align with your workflow needs.Size and Workspace Capacity
Choosing the right size depends on your available space and the scale of your work. Larger workbenches like the Jocisland 84-inch model offer extensive surface area and storage, suitable for professional shops, but they require more room and higher investment. Smaller options, such as the YITAHOME 48-inch model, fit compact workshops or home garages but may limit workspace. Consider your typical projects and storage needs to avoid purchasing a workbench that’s either too cramped or unnecessarily large and costly.
Material and Finish Quality
Durability hinges on the quality of stainless steel used. Look for models with thick, corrosion-resistant steel that can withstand moisture, spills, and heavy use. Cheaper finishes may chip or rust over time, reducing longevity. A smooth, easy-to-clean surface is also beneficial for maintaining hygiene and appearance. Higher-end models often feature better finishing processes that extend lifespan, especially in commercial or demanding environments.
Storage Configuration and Accessibility
The number and size of drawers influence how well you can organize tools and supplies. Deeper or wider drawers facilitate storing larger items, while multiple smaller drawers help keep small parts sorted. Be mindful of drawer weight capacity and ease of opening—heavy or stiff drawers can hinder workflow. Some models include additional storage like shelves or paper towel holders, which can streamline tasks but may add to the overall footprint or cost.
Price and Value
Pricing varies substantially based on size, features, and brand reputation. More affordable options might lack advanced features or robust construction but can suffice for light or hobbyist use. Premium models, while more expensive, often provide longer-lasting materials and better ergonomics, making them worthwhile investments for professional settings. Weigh the cost against your expected usage to decide whether a budget-friendly model offers sufficient durability and features.
Additional Features and Accessories
Extras like built-in shelves, paper towel holders, or adjustable legs enhance functionality but also add complexity and cost. Consider which features truly improve your workflow; unnecessary additions can clutter your workspace or inflate the price. Some workbenches include locking drawers or customizable configurations, offering greater security and flexibility for different tasks. Think about your priorities—organization, safety, or convenience—and select a model that aligns accordingly.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use a stainless steel workbench with drawers outdoors?
Yes, stainless steel is naturally resistant to rust and corrosion, making it suitable for outdoor environments. However, it’s important to choose a model with a high-quality finish and proper sealing to ensure long-term durability against weather elements.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ning and applying protective coatings, can extend the lifespan of your workbench outdoors. Avoid leaving harsh chemicals or moisture on the surface for extended periods to prevent potential damage.
Are all stainless steel workbenches with drawers suitable for heavy-duty use?
Not all models are built for heavy-duty applications. Cheaper or thinner steel options may bend or warp under significant weight or stress. Look for workbenches with thicker gauge steel, reinforced joints, and high-capacity drawers if you plan to store heavy tools or equipment. Reading product specifications and customer reviews can help identify models designed for demanding environments, whether in a commercial workshop or industrial setting.
How important is the weight of the workbench when choosing for a small garage?
The weight of a stainless steel workbench affects both stability and portability. Heavier models tend to be more stable during use, especially when working with forceful tools or equipment. However, very heavy benches can be difficult to move or reposition, which is a consideration in small or flexible workspaces. If you need flexibility, look for a balance—sturdy enough to stay put but with features like lockable wheels for mobility when needed.
Should I prioritize drawers or open shelving on my workbench?
This depends on your organizational needs. Drawers provide secure, dust-free storage for small parts and tools, helping keep your workspace tidy. Open shelving offers quick access to larger items and frequently used materials, simplifying workflow. Many professional setups combine both for maximum efficiency. Consider what you access most often and choose a workbench that balances both options if possible.
What maintenance does a stainless steel workbench require?
Stainless steel workbenches are relatively low-maintenance but still benefit from regular cleaning with mild soap and water to remove dirt and grease.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ch or dull the surface. Periodic inspection for rust or corrosion, especially in humid environments, helps catch issues early. Applying a protective coating or oil can enhance resistance, and keeping the surface dry prolongs its appearance and functionality.
